Combined sheet pile walls are typically formed by joining a pair of sheet pile sections with regularly spaced king pile patterns. sheet Combined sheet pile walls are mostly used in marine applications where they provide increased stiffness combined to regular sheet pile walls. In marine applications, it is common for the king piles to be driven to a greater depth so that greater axial capacity is obtained.
Combined steel sheet piling is used in many types of temporary works and permanent structures. The sections are designed to provide the maximum strength and durability. The design of the section interlocks facilitates pitching and driving and results in a continuous wall with a series of closely fitting joints. Care should be taken since special interlocks are required between the king piles and the sheet pile walls. Corrosion protection is required for permanent combined sheet pile walls.

King pile wall advantages:
Increased wall stiffness
Increased wall moment resistance
Sheet piles can be terminated at higher elevations
King piles can extend deeper to better bearing strata
Might offer a better alternative to other systems
Ideal for heavy marine applications
King pile wall disadvantages:
Increased cost when compared to standard sheet piles
Installation more complex compared to sheet piles
Greater coating surface when compared to sheet piles
